Os propongo un reto con los alias...

EnZo

En mis tiempos de friki a hacer configs, me frikee sobre todo ha hacer alias, alias a sako, y se me ocurrio uno que para mi fue lo mejor q hice. Asi que os propongo hacerlo con estos datos.

Un alias que cuando pulses la tecla de shift se active y haga:

  1. En vez de ir corriendo vaya andando, pero que no deje de andar hasta que sea desactivado.

  2. Que los sonidos hambientales queden en silencio.

  3. Que sume 0.5 de volumen. Y que lo reste cuando se desactive. Osea que si tienes de volumen 1 se sume 1.5 o si tienes 1.2 q se sume 1.7 para que asi se escuchen mas los pasos del enemigo. (Aconsejo hacer un sistema de volumen para este factor).

  4. Cuando se active y se desactive saldra un mensaje de developer identificando el estado de alias.

  5. El alias se desactivara de dos formas. (Cndo ste activado)
    5.1 Cuando se pulse de nuevo shift.
    5.2 Cuando se pulse el boton de atacar del raton.

En ambos casos el volumen volvera a su estado normal, volvera al estado de correr, saldra el mensaje de desactivado.

Yo tengo mi propia solucion :D os invito a hacerlo ;)

P

¬¬ !!! q tal si te echas novia?

XeNiuM

me parece bien :D

KMYA

no veo nada dificil en eso...

alias raro on
alias on "+speed; stopsound; volumen +0.5; developer 1; echo mensaje; developer 0; alias raro off; bind tecla_disparo off"
alias of "-speed; developer 1; echo mensaje; developer 0; alias raro on; bind tecla_disparo +attack"

bind shift raro

Que no usas un volumen determinado o se usas el script de subir o bajar el volumen con una tecla o otra, pues añadiendo ahi un script para que guarde el volumen actual + 0.5 y en lugar de volumen +0.5 se pone el nombre del alias

Milla

no va

KMYA

Claro que no va porque es un borrador, no está nada hecho... Además solo función al 100% bajo CS 1.5

Bien hecho seria algo como (En caso de tener volumen a 1, si se tiene otro volumen, pues seria en lugar de volume 1.5 pones el tuyo + 0.5 y en lugar de volume 1 poner el tuyo de siempre):

alias raro on
alias on "+speed; stopsound; volume 1.5; developer 1; echo Script raro activado; developer 0; alias raro off; bind tecla_disparo off"
alias of "-speed; volume 1; developer 1; echo Script raro desactivado; developer 0; alias raro on; bind tecla_disparo +attack"
bind shift raro

Y luego si se usa el script de subir y bajar el volumen como este:

alias vup silen
alias vdn vol_9
alias silen "volume 0.0; d1; echo Nivel del sonido 0.0; d0; alias vup vol_1; alias vdn vol_0"
alias vol_1 "volume 0.2; d1; echo Nivel del sonido 0.2; d0; alias vup vol_2; alias vdn silen"
alias vol_2 "volume 0.4; d1; echo Nivel del sonido 0.4; d0; alias vup vol_3; alias vdn vol_1"
alias vol_3 "volume 0.6; d1; echo Nivel del sonido 0.6; d0; alias vup vol_4; alias vdn vol_2"
alias vol_4 "volume 0.8; d1; echo Nivel del sonido 0.8; d0; alias vup vol_5; alias vdn vol_3"
alias vol_5 "volume 1.0; d1; echo Nivel del sonido 1.0; d0; alias vup vol_6; alias vdn vol_4"
alias vol_6 "volume 1.2; d1; echo Nivel del sonido 1.2; d0; alias vup vol_7; alias vdn vol_5"
alias vol_7 "volume 1.4; d1; echo Nivel del sonido 1.4; d0; alias vup vol_8; alias vdn vol_6"
alias vol_8 "volume 1.6; d1; echo Nivel del sonido 1.6; d0; alias vup vol_9; alias vdn vol_7"
alias vol_9 "volume 1.8; d1; echo Nivel del sonido 1.8; d0; alias vup vol_0; alias vdn vol_8"
alias vol_0 "volume 2.0; d1; echo Nivel del sonido 2.0; d0; alias vup silen; alias vdn vol_9"

bind tecla vup --> Tecla para subir de volumen
bind tecla vdn --> Tecla para bajar de volumen

Sustituirlo por este otro:

alias vup silen
alias vdn vol_9
volume 2
alias silen "volume 0.0; d1; echo Nivel del sonido 0.0; d0; alias vup vol_1; alias vdn vol_0; alias vol+ vol00; alias vol- silen"
alias vol_1 "volume 0.2; d1; echo Nivel del sonido 0.2; d0; alias vup vol_2; alias vdn silen; alias vol+ vol01;
alias vol- vol_1"
alias vol_2 "volume 0.4; d1; echo Nivel del sonido 0.4; d0; alias vup vol_3; alias vdn vol_1; alias vol+ vol02; alias vol- vol_2"
alias vol_3 "volume 0.6; d1; echo Nivel del sonido 0.6; d0; alias vup vol_4; alias vdn vol_2; alias vol+ vol03; alias vol- vol_3"
alias vol_4 "volume 0.8; d1; echo Nivel del sonido 0.8; d0; alias vup vol_5; alias vdn vol_3; alias vol+ vol04; alias vol- vol_4"
alias vol_5 "volume 1.0; d1; echo Nivel del sonido 1.0; d0; alias vup vol_6; alias vdn vol_4; alias vol+ vol05; alias vol- vol_5"
alias vol_6 "volume 1.2; d1; echo Nivel del sonido 1.2; d0; alias vup vol_7; alias vdn vol_5; alias vol+ vol06; alias vol- vol_6"
alias vol_7 "volume 1.4; d1; echo Nivel del sonido 1.4; d0; alias vup vol_8; alias vdn vol_6; alias vol+ vol07; alias vol- vol_7"
alias vol_8 "volume 1.6; d1; echo Nivel del sonido 1.6; d0; alias vup vol_9; alias vdn vol_7; alias vol+ vol08; alias vol- vol_8"
alias vol_9 "volume 1.8; d1; echo Nivel del sonido 1.8; d0; alias vup vol_0; alias vdn vol_8; alias vol+ vol09; alias vol- vol_9"
alias vol_0 "volume 2.0; d1; echo Nivel del sonido 2.0; d0; alias vup silen; alias vdn vol_9; alias vol+ vol10; alias vol- vol_0"

bind tecla vup
bind tecla vdn

Añadiendo un script como este otro:

alias vol00 "volume 0.5"
alias vol01 "volume 0.7"
alias vol02 "volume 0.9"
alias vol03 "volume 1.1"
alias vol04 "volume 1.3"
alias vol05 "volume 1.5"
alias vol06 "volume 1.7"
alias vol07 "volume 1.9"
alias vol08 "volume 2.1"
alias vol09 "volume 2.3"
alias vol10 "volume 2.5"

Y el script anterior se queda de esta forma:

alias raro on
alias on "+speed; stopsound; vol+; developer 1; echo Script raro activado; developer 0; alias raro off; bind tecla_disparo off"
alias of "-speed; vol-; developer 1; echo Script raro desactivado; developer 0; alias raro on; bind tecla_disparo +attack"
bind shift raro

Este ya si no ha pasado nada con el copy & paste debe funcionar... o deberia de funcionar...

Mc_KaNaN

a esto lo llamas reto dificil????? xDDDDDDDDDDDD

:D :D :D :D :D :D

Garendetsu

Este lo que pasa es que es un pipas y quiere saber como hacerlo y punto.

CID1

mi cfg tiene todo lo del volume ;) pero trankilos k no la voi a subir para k vosotros cojais i os la bajeis i ala todo solucionado ;) es cosa de ir aprendiendo ;)

KMYA

Es cosa de gusto. Hay gente que le guta la programación, otros no... Para aquellos que le gusten programar... esto es facil...